Attracting over 110,000 shoppers, the Sands Shopping Carnival has proven to become a must go leisure and shopping destination.

he Sands Shopping Carnival 2025 that took place from July 17-19 at The Venetian® Macao’s Cotai Expo, was Macao’s biggest sale event featuring overwhelming attention from local residents and visitors. With almost 110,000 visitors over its shortened three-day tenure the event fell tantalisingly short of last year’s four-day carnival attendance. Since it’s launch in 2020, the carnival has welcomed over 640,000 guests to the event, cementing its status as an annual highlight to be enjoyed by both local residents and tourists alike.

Hosted by Sands China Ltd. and co-organised by the Macao Chamber of Commerce the carnival reached its sixth edition in 2025. Sands China’s annual programme has continued to bring together local SMEs, Sands retailers, NGOs and the arts and culture sector. A Multi-Faceted Carnival Experience

The fair in 2019 spanned a large set-up that included over 580 booths in eight different exhibition areas. These zones were Sands retailers, household products, gourmet and wine, food court, coffee, Macao cultural and creative, play and fun, and Macao specialties and souvenirs. The introduction of a coffee zone marked the latest trend, reflecting the new café scene in Macao. This zone included a number of renowned coffee brands to satisfy the appetite for coffee as was befitting current consumer spending trends.

A particular highlight this year was the open-mic busking zone just outside the coffee zone. This edition saw guests express their musical side, making the event a livelier event and a more community-driven event. Lively performances and community-based initiatives

A key feature of the carnival was the ICBC ePay Presents: Greater Bay Area Karaoke King Singing Competition. Over 100 contestants from the Greater Bay Area participated in this fun event to be an extra-layer of fun at the Carnival and to represent the region’s cultures. It was a carnival atmosphere and the crowd’s rousing cheer and applause highlighted the happiness that competition can bring.

Demonstrating its strong commitment to being part of the community, a number of local organisations were also featured at the carnival. The number of participating community organizations over the last six years has also grown dramatically from three in its first year to this year’s record 19. These entities had a significant role in the sensitization of the participants to their services and social inclusion. Sands Cares Ambassadors hosted the event onsite, supporting local organizations with activities that helped them maximize their day.

Among the most impressive community programmes was the BOC Smart Kids Presents: Little Master Chef Workshop, conducted by Sands China’s food and beverage team. This practical workshop provided parents with the chance to work alongside their children to create sushi, inspiring creativity and developing cooking ability. Fostering local businesses and entrepreneurs has always been at the core of the carnival. In 2025, Sands China feted the businesses from the Community Revitalisation Series – Entrepreneurship Recruitment Programme for Rua das Estalagens and the local retailers of the former Iec Long Firecracker Factory to display their products. This program was designed to help these businesses to build up their local customer base by providing them a platform to reach as many people as possible which were local to their business.

The Sands EmpowHER team was also part of the carnival and hosted a booth that supported female entrepreneurs working in Sands China. The move not only encouraged hands-on learning but also gave women a unique opportunity to demonstrate their entrepreneurial skills and enable career opportunities.
